Understanding ADHD Assessments in the UK
Attention Deficit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ental condition that can considerably impact people' daily lives. With growing awareness and approval of this condition, ADHD assessments in the UK have actually become progressively essential for making sure that those with ADHD get the support and treatment they require. This blog site post intends to provide an informative summary of ADHD assessments in the UK, outlining the assessment procedure, what to expect, and vital points of consideration.
What is ADHD?
ADHD is characterized by a relentless pattern of negligence, hyperactivity, and impulsivity that interferes with functioning or advancement. The assessment for ADHD generally includes numerous steps, ensuring an extensive review of the individual's history and existing performance. Below is an introduction of the standard assessment treatment:
Steps in the ADHD Assessment ProcessActionDescriptionReferralIndividuals may be referred for assessment by doctor, teachers, or self-referral.Clinical InterviewA detailed interview with a certified psychological health expert to collect developmental and behavioral history.Standardized QuestionnairesUsage of ADHD-specific questionnaires (e.g., ADHD Rating Scale) filled out by moms and dads, teachers, and the person.Observational AssessmentObservations made in different settings to assess habits and interaction patterns.Cognitive TestingAssessments may consist of IQ tests and evaluations of executive function or academic skills.Feedback SessionA session to talk about outcomes, offer a diagnosis (if applicable), and overview treatment alternatives.Who Can Conduct an ADHD Assessment?

An ADHD assessment can take numerous hours and may be conducted over numerous sessions. Here's what individuals can normally anticipate:
Pre-Assessment Questionnaires: Participants may require to complete various questionnaires regarding their habits and psychological functioning.In-depth Interviews: Comprehensive interviews will cover developmental history, household history, and particular issues connected to attention and behavior.Feedback on Findings: After resources and findings are examined, feedback will be supplied relating to diagnosis and suggestions.Treatment Options Post-Assessment
Depending upon the outcomes of the assessment, numerous treatment options might be suggested. These can include:
Medication: Commonly prescribed medications consist of stimulants (e.g., methylphenidate) and non-stimulants.Psychotherapy: Various therapeutic methods can help improve coping methods, self-regulation, and emotional management.Educational Support: Individualized Education Plans (IEPs) might be executed for students, with lodgings made in the classroom.Moms And Dad or Family Support: Family therapy or training can help moms and dads manage behavioral problems and comprehend their child's requirements.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. How long does the ADHD assessment take in the UK?
ADHD assessments can take from a couple of hours to a complete day depending upon the intricacy of the case and the number of assessments needed.
2. Who can refer someone for an ADHD assessment?
Recommendations can be made by healthcare experts such as GPs, teachers, or through self-referral.
3. Is there an age limitation for ADHD assessment?
ADHD can be detected at any age, although signs need to exist from youth. Assessments in adults may take into account retrospective evidence of signs in youth.
4. Are there any expenses related to ADHD assessments?
Costs might vary; NHS assessments are usually complimentary, but private adhd assessments can vary from hundreds to thousands of pounds.
